This week we take you back nearly 20 years as we revisit the preparation for Walt Disney World's 25th anniversary in 1996. One of the ways Disney celebrated this milestone was to completely desecrate its most enduring park icon, as they turned Cinderella Castle into a very gaudy and heavily decorated birthday cake. The first step was to...gulp...paint the entire castle pink. Here we see this first step of the transformation in process, along with what has become an all too familiar prop in the shadow of the castle in recent years...a crane, which can be seen behind it in the photo.
